LoK - Antian (Teenager)

By
Published:
488 Views

Description

Name: Antian (a more common name given to daughters of the Fire Nation)

Alias: Weatherbender

Nationality: Southern Water Tribe
Ethnicity: Water Tribe (mother), Fire Nation (Father)
Homeland: Fire Nation, raised in the Southern Water Tribe after she turned six
Age: 37 (Book One: Air)

Gender: Female
Height: Around 5’9”
Hair Colour: Medium brown
Eye Colour: Violet (left eye is a milky-pink as a result of being both scarred and half-blinded)

Element: Water
Fighting Style: Waterbending (Southern), Bloodbending - she has also incorporated movements into her attacks that are more commonly used by and/or to evade Firebenders, as a result of her upbringing during her younger years

Waterbending: Antian utilizes a variety of different methods to fight using Waterbending, including small or large bodies of water, ice, snow and even clouds. She has gained a reputation for being able to make such good use of the water in the air and in the clouds, that she can make it rain over fairly large areas, earning her her alias. She also uses her own body’s water to achieve her means.

Healing: Antian learned to heal from her Mother and, after many years of training, and even seeking out the tutelage of Master Waterbender Katara, Antian learned how to use people’s own body water to heal them, although this apparently requires a great deal of strength and concentration, and can leave her physically exhausted.

Bloodbending: The forbidden technique taught to her by Yakone, and one which she practiced somewhat half-heartedly, it was in fact the story of her Mother using it to take away a person’s Bending, that led Noatak to use it himself, later on in his life, as Amon...

Personality: Usually friendly and gentle in her day-to-day activities, with an uncommon kindness despite her upbringing, Antian has the potential to become sharp and hot-tempered, and won’t hesitate to speak her mind if she has had enough. She can also become quite emotional at times, too, with a passionate and reckless streak that she seems to share with Korra. Her downfall, at times, it would seem, is that she is TOO passionate - her past with Noatak and Tarrlok often brings her to conflict with herself and, eventually, with others...

Strengths: Agility, ability to often predict her opponent’s movements, kicks and speed
Weaknesses: She is highly vulnerable to attacks from her left side and, as such, does not use her arms much in close-combat, she is also somewhat scared of fire which often leads to extortion or retreat

Story: Born to a Firebending Father (Gang) after being conceived during a one-night-stand with his attendant (Calla), she spent the first six years of her life being tormented and mistreated by him and his Firebending wife (Nhia) and their three Firebending daughters (triplets; Liudan, Khailin and Xaforn). Gang did not tell his wife that Calla was actually Antian’s Mother, instead it was arranged that when Nhia was unconscious during Khailin's birth, that Antian was meant to be her "twin") but, when she witnessed Antian practicing her Waterbending with Calla, she burned Antian in an eerily similar event to Prince Zuko’s situation, with Calla stepping in at the last minute, and using Bloodbending to strip Nhia of her powers. However, with this forbidden move, she became a fugitive and, in her final acts before being captured, brought her daughter to none other than Yakone, a man whom she had met in her past and whom, apparently, owed her a favour. She had initially just intended to take Antian to safety in her homeland but, upon recognizing Yakone by his voice, threatened to reveal his true identity if he did not look after her daughter, and he begrudgingly agreed, although seemed to take interest in the fact that she was a Waterbender, and that Calla herself was able to Bloodbend. Before she departed, Calla healed Antian’s scar as best as she could, though her daughter was still left half-blind. She then vanished, and was never seen by her daughter again.

Growing up in the Southern Water Tribe with Yakone and her family, she quickly befriended Noatak and Tarrlok, practicing her Waterbending and, eventually, finding out about the boys’ secret Bloodbending lessons. Although initially angry, especially at Noatak for Bloodbending helpless animals (such as a Raccoon-Fox that she ended up saving, and keeping as a pet named Yun), she was eventually persuaded by Yakone to learn as well. In the interest of marrying off one of his sons to Antian, he persuaded Noatak to craft Antian a betrothal necklace, which he did, although Tarrlok was skeptical and also a little bit jealous. As such, it was many years before Tarrlok told her what really happened on the night that Noatak disappeared and, as a result, so did she, resolving never to have anything to do with him again, although her heart’s feelings eventually got the better of her, and sought him out, many years later. She hoped that Noatak was still alive.
